
The Hudson Perinatal Breastfeeding Initiative, funded by the New Jersey Department of Health and Senior Services, Women Infants and Children Program (WIC), encourages breastfeeding as the optimal and normal infant feeding choice among women in Hudson County. The initiative includes prenatal and postpartum classes, postpartum consultation and support, a peer counselor hospital visitation program, telephone support and follow up, and home visitations.
Breastfeeding mothers in the community are trained as peer counselors to provide community education through classes, individualized instruction, health fairs, and community baby shower events. The breastfeeding initiative collaborates with other HPC programs to provide breastfeeding education to participants who are enrolled in the WIC program.
The Hudson Breastfeeding Initiative also offers education and support to health care practitioners and hospitals in Hudson County. As part of the breastfeeding initiative, The Hudson Breastfeeding Alliance (HBA) works to promote and support breastfeeding in the hospital environment, community health centers and private health practices. HBA holds four yearly meetings to coordinate breastfeeding protection, promotion and support in Hudson County birth hospitals and other healthcare facilities.
